What is Leadfeeder?

Leadfeeder helps to accelerate marketing and sales efforts, by connecting with our Google Analytics account and cleverly combining visitor information with IP address data.  This provides background information on which companies have been visiting our website, the pages they’ve viewed, the duration of the page visit, how they found us, and possible contacts to reach out to from that business. We can follow accounts which view our profile regularly and receive notifications every time they’ve viewed our website. Without being too (creepy) we give the company a follow on LinkedIn or have our marketing team reach out to possible leads with a newsletter or intro letter. This allows us to spend less time and effort resourcing new leads.

Leadfeeder also integrates with our CRM, which in our case is Salesforce and sends leads direct to the CRM. Leadfeeder also links with our email provider MailChimp and 1,000+ apps which helps to further accelerate our sales and marketing efforts. Leadfeeder ranks our visitors by engagement, enabling our marketing team to reach out to the leads by the contact information already gathered. We are also able to embed Leadfeeder data into our Google data studio reports.
